Righteousness and Confidence
by Dr. (Mrs) Lizzy Johnson-Suleman

TODAY’S SCRIPTURE: Zechariah 9-10

TEXT: “If iniquity be in thine hand, put it far away, and let not wickedness dwell in thy tabernacles. For then shalt thou lift up thy face without spot; yea, thou shalt be stedfast, and shalt not fear.”
Job 11 :14 – 15.

One great sponsor of confidence and boldness is righteousness. Hence scripture says, “The wicked flee when no man pursueth: but the righteous are bold as a lion.” Prov. 28 :1.

The righteous has ‘no skeleton in his closet’, he walks uprighty following the instructions and laid down principles, so he walks confidently and his bold when called upon to defend his course and also bold in the face of opposition.

But the wicked, also called the sinner lacks confidence because sin is a deflator of confidence. It sponsors fear, guilt and insecurity. That is why when a sinner is taken unaware on an issue which he is guilty, he fidget and stutters in his speech because sin punctures confidence. But when given room to prepare, the sinner resolves to lying to cover up himself which is still lack of confidence and competence because they walk hand in hand.

Before Adam and Eve disobeyed God in the garden of Eden, there was no record of them hiding from the presence of God. But when they sinned by disobeying God’s command, scripture says, “And they heard the voice of the LORD God walking in the garden in the cool of the day: and Adam and his wife hid themselves from the presence of the LORD God amongst the trees of the garden.” Gen. 3 :8.

Sin punctured their confidence and reduced them to taking cover in a lesser creature which they named. That is what happens whenever you leave your status of righteousness by committing sin. Rather than being bold and confidence, you sink more in sin by taking cover in lies thereby selling out to the devil.

Righteousness sponsors boldness but sin generates fear. Hence when God called Adam and said unto him, “Where art thou?” Adam said, I heard thy voice in the garden, and I was afraid, because I was naked: and I hid myself. Gen. 3 :9 – 10.

Child of God, we are the righteousness of God in Christ Jesus, salvation gave us that gift, freely. Let us therefore walk uprighty and not trade our confidence to the devil by committing sin.
